Learning From Local Authority Projects : External Engagement

This external engagement section provides guidance on delivering help at a more local level. Signposting, outreach and community engagement are the main areas of focus. The majority of materials are centred around direct contact with the Armed Forces Community, with examples of single points of contact, Veterans Hubs and a large array of unique practices that have been collected from different Local Authorities.

The repository was designed so that future work on the Armed Forces Covenant would develop rather than duplicate anything that has been created previously. This section will therefore provide processes or methods that can be used in your local authority with minor tweaks.
